The Aging Room Cigars are a part of the Boutique Blends brand and are a relatively new brand, having come on the scene in 2010, when cigars were released in small batches. A ’boutique’ blend is a cigar that has been created under one name. The same company controls the manufacturing process from cultivation to distribution. Each batch, such as the Aging Room M365, is never produced in large quantities and quality control is always strict thus achieving brand consistency.
When Boutique Blends use the term “small batch” thats what they really mean. When brand owner Rafael Nodal finds a particular batch of tobacco, he creates only a finite amount of cigars and once that tobacco is finished, it’s finished! No tobacco substitutions will be made over time to sustain the brand, no matter what the demand. Nor does he change the blend in hopes that no one will notice. Now that is dedication to the craft. As Rafael himself says, “We are not producing cigars for everyone. We are introducing new blends for educated consumers that are looking for cigars with complexity and character.”

Created by Zino Davidoff, who originally started producing cigars in Cuba circa 1969. The 1970's saw overwhelming success for the Davidoff brand as cigar shops opened to the public all over the world selling what is now regarded as a premium and exceptional range of cigars crafted in the then new "El Laguito" factory in the suburbs of Havana. Now made in the Dominican Republic.

Tom Mulder, a cigar aficionado from The Netherlands, partnered up with the oldest factory in Nicaragua, Joya de Nicaragua to create his brand, La Sagrada Familia. Nicarao cigars are known for their ultra-boutique handmade masterpieces and you may have even come across them a time or two since they have been around a while. What you may not know is that the name comes from the sixteenth century when Spanish Conquistador Gil Gonzalez Dávila was first European to come to Central America. The native leader, Chief Nicarao, gave the Conquistador brown leaves to smoke. The Conquistador was impressed and named the new region Nicaragua after the Chief.

Like all innovative products, the nub started as a mere idea at the Oliva factory in Nicaragua. The torcedor wanted to make a cigar that hit its sweet spot at first light. No fuss, no muss – no wait. The result is the Nub cigar.
The Nub by Olivia comes in a variety of wrappers, but each and every one uses captivating Nicaraguan tobacco. Despite its short length, the Nub burns just as long as a full sized Toro or Churchill. In fact, this uniquely stout cigar successfully captures the flavor and body of the last four, five inches of a traditional cigar all the way through. You get the ‘sweet spot’ all the way through.
The Oliva Cigar story began in the late 1800s, when Melanio Oliva started growing cigar tobacco in Cuba. His heirs carried on the family tradition in the fields, but it was his grandson Gilberto Oliva Sr. who began making cigars. He left his native Cuba in 1964, and eventually started working for the Plasencia family in Honduras. In 1995 he and his son Gilberto Jr. created a cigar within Plasencia’s factory called Gilberto Oliva. A year later, they set out to open a factory of their own, and shortened their brand name to Oliva.

What distinguishes PDR from many of the other boutique cigars is the fact that they uses a complex rolling technique called “Entubado” which is a technique of bunching the filler tobacco. This lets you build a more airy and complex filler bunch by adding more tobacco but rolling it in a way that the draw is always perfect. The end result is an uncompromisingly rich smoke with massive clouds of tobacco goodness!
As for the flavor, Abe Flores has created his very unique blends using only the finest blend of Dominican, Nicaraguan and rare Brazilian tobaccos.
The premium handmade lineup of Plasencia cigars are the namesake of one of the most influential people currently active in the cigar industry, Nestor Plasencia. With factories in both Honduras and Nicaragua, there’s nothing this cigar maker can’t do; he grows his own tobacco, rolls his own cigars and has helped pioneer the vision of other cigar brands including Rocky Patel and Alec Bradley, just to name a few. Because of his heavy involvement in all aspects of cigar creation, you are in for an enjoyable experience when you smoke anyone of his cigars.

Vegafina cigars are hand-rolled at the famous Tabacalera de Garcia factory in the Dominican Republic, the same factory that produces Montecristo, H. Upmann, and Romeo y Julieta cigars. Combining a creamy Ecuadorian Connecticut Shade wrapper with smooth tobaccos from Columbia, Honduras, and the Dominican Republic, Vegafina exudes satisfying mild character with nuances of chocolate, caramel, and leather.
